The Collective Agreement in Canada
Author: FĂ©lix Quinet
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category : Collective bargaining
Languages : en
Pages : 208
Book Description
Series of 8 papers on the collective agreement in Canada - covers methodology for analysis of agreements, and studies agreements effective in manufacturing industries in 1962, and the implications therefor of technological change.

Collective Bargaining by Public Employees in Canada
Author: Harry William Arthurs
Publisher: Ann Arbor: Institute of Labor and Industrial Relations, University of Michigan-Wayne State University
ISBN:
Category : Political Science
Languages : en
Pages : 184
Book Description
Study of labour relations in public administration in Canada - comprises 5 models of collective bargaining by civil servants and public servants in federal or provincial services, (ontario), covers trade unionisation, the right to strike, grievance procedures, labour discipline, dispute settlements, etc., and comments on relevant labour legislation.
